Family stay In Waikiki
Stayed here for 6 x nights as a family (1 x queen room, 2 x adjoining rooms for parents + kids). There seems to be a million hotels to choose from in Waikiki, however, this seemed to be the only one I could find that could offer adjoining rooms during our stay period. I've stayed at lot's of Doubletree Hilton and I think they're fine - I'm a Hilton Gold Member. We arrived a bit early and were told our rooms wouldn't be available 'till normal check-in time (3pm) - I think we got rooms about 2.30pm. They let us leave our luggage while we waited / went walking. I didn't get any real recognition as a Gold Member at check-in - not a problem for me, but Hilton always ask about that if I do a survey. Hilton Gold at this property does get you an $18USD credit per person per day hotel credit and some free Hilton Cookies - possibly every day if you ask nicely. NOTE - this credit is NOT available to use in the on-site Hiking Cafe. The hotel itself is not too flashy, but well located (for us) between the tourist strip and Ala Moana Mall. We were on floors 8 and 11 and both rooms had Ok views - but not like the big beachfront hotels of course - but then you're not paying as much either. Nice, spacious rooms with all the usual room amenities / features - I did like the bedside USB-C / Power units - great for bedside phones. The bed was softly firm and comfortable (for us). I'm not a fan of paying the money they charge for hotel breakfasts and there's several options a couple of minutes walk from the hotel for brekky. There's a bunch of Food trucks across the road as well. The pool area that the kids HAD to have was nice and uncrowded - however, there's no bar / food service at the pool and for this you have to got to the Lobby and order something from Trees Cafe (where hotel breakfast happens) - it doesn't open until 5.30pm after lunch service. Seems kind of weird that you can't easily get a drink by the pool...... Everything about this property is "fine", not memorable or amazing and perhaps this is more of a business hotel judging by the amount of function rooms for the size of the hotel. However, judging by the other prices I saw when planning, this hotel was still good value-for-money. Any hey....... you're in Hawaii, so can't complain too much.
